November 10, 2010

Mozilla Celebrates 6 Years of Firefox

Six years ago on the 9th of November, 2004, Mozilla released version 1.0 of its open source Firefox web browser, which is now available in more than 70 languages and is used by nearly 25% of internet users

Read more at The H
Click Here!